Chelsea teenager Estevao Willian scored his first senior goal for Brazil in spectacular fashion, netting a bicycle kick during a 3-0 win over Chile in the World Cup qualifier. The 18-year-old, already making waves in the Premier League, earned the loudest cheer inside the Maracana and capped his standout display with an acrobatic opener that lit up the night.

Estevao broke the deadlock in the 38th minute after Raphinha’s shot was blocked inside the box. The ball looped into the air, and the Chelsea starlet improvised brilliantly with a bicycle kick from barely yards from the goal line. His strike set the tone for a dominant performance that ended in a comfortable 3-0 victory for Carlo Ancelotti's side.

Estevao’s wonder goal is another sign of his rapid rise since joining Chelsea from Palmeiras this summer. He has already impressed in the Premier League, collecting an assist and showcasing his flair in early matches with the Blues. His display for Brazil will only raise expectations as he cements his reputation as one of football’s brightest young talents.

Brazil have already booked their ticket to the 2026 World Cup, allowing Ancelotti to further evaluate Estevao in the coming months. Chelsea, meanwhile, will be eager to see him translate international confidence back into club form. With his breakthrough moment now secured, the teenager’s momentum shows no sign of slowing.
